Takasaki Arena is a modern and impressive sports and concert venue located in the city of Takasaki, Japan. This multi-purpose complex is a striking example of modern Japanese architecture and serves as a major venue for a variety of events, from sporting competitions to large-scale concerts, attracting both locals and visitors alike.
